My kindergartener's class was using the Magic Treehouse book series as part of their Tools of the Mind curriculum. While they were reading "Afternoon on the Amazon" and studying the rain forest, I came across this fun game suggested for children by the Prince of Wales' Rainforests Project (how posh!). I used the pages offered there to put together all the things you need to play the game in a classroom.

Game instructions are included in the PDF doc. The way we went about this in class was to post the large pages and take some time talking about each animal first. I was shocked by how much they knew before I got it there-- props to our awesome teachers-- they all had a chant, "Emergent, Canopy, Understory, Forest Floor!"

After that discussion, start the game. The adult plays Mr. Crocodile. Kindergarteners appreciate sound effects and acting, even if it's bad.

Items needed for a class project: all pages from my PDF document, print enough copies of page 2 so that you have enough cards for the kids playing (class size / 9). If you want to get fancy, bring some blue fabric to put down as the river.
